White County Economic Development Director Randy Mitchell confirmed to WLFI-TV the owners of Indiana Beach in Monticello were unsuccessful in finding buyers for the property.
The park has been owned by Apex Parks Group since 2015. Mitchell told the station he was informed the closure was for financial reasons and Apex Parks also closed three additional amusement parks.
According to WLFI, Indiana Beach still has nearly 30 employees, though it is uncertain what the future will hold for those jobs.
